Responsibilities
- Documents in accordance with department policy and maintains telemetry logbook.
- Observes monitors, recognizing and documenting normal and abnormal EKG patterns, and promptly notifies nursing staff of any abnormalities.
- Maintains monitor alarms per policy, verifies that alarms are set and audible every shift, and troubleshoots monitors as needed.
- Participates in practice changes resulting from performance improvement activities, demonstrating accurate documentation and monitoring of activities, and supporting departmental quality standards and initiatives.
- Exhibits a desire to learn and upgrade skills, performing other duties as assigned or directed to ensure the smooth operation of the department or unit.
- Maintains telemetry printout during cardiac arrest and as indicated.
- Ensures effective communication with the healthcare team regarding patient status and any changes observed.
- Assists in maintaining a clean and organized work environment, ensuring equipment is properly sanitized and stored.
- Participates in ongoing education and training to stay current with best practices and departmental procedures.
